Method
- Add cream cheese and milk into saucepan over medium-low heat while stirring until smooth and creamy.
- Mix shredded pepper jack cheese gradually into warm mixture until completely melted without clumps remaining.
- Stir Rotel tomatoes, garlic powder, and smoked paprika into cheese mixture until evenly combined throughout.
- Simmer gently for several minutes until dip thickens slightly and develops silky scoopable texture for serving.
- Transfer dip into slow cooker or serving bowl and keep warm beside chips and fresh vegetables.
